2016 Clemson QB commit is scheduled to compete today- as are Wake commit #16 QB Jamie Newman, scar commit Brandon McIlwain, UGA's Jacob Eason, and others. Malik Henry, an FSU commit, is scheduled to compete after making headlines this week with his dismissal from IMG Academy. Sources say he clashed with coaches and had 'recurring attitude issues.' This kid transfers more than a troubled SEC player. One interesting prospect to watch could be Duke commit Chazz Surratt, who was offered by Clemson. I've been following him for a while and definitely see his potential. He's a pretty good athlete who has lined up at multiple positions. Here's what I have on him and Cooper, FWIW-

QB- Zerrick Cooper 6-3 200 Jonesboro, GA Jonesboro HS

Committed to CU on 10/11/14. "Cooper said it was the combination of the relationship he has formed with Swinney and his top recruiter Chad Morris that made him commit. I feel like I can trust them,” Cooper said. “I think we have a good relationship that a coach and player needs. I knew of my decision before the visit Saturday. I just felt comfortable making the decision right now.” Invited to Nike Elite 11 QB Camp. MVP of the Cam Newton 7 on 7 series in Atlanta. Recorded a 4.7 40 yard dash. As a Jr, 83-156 1,200 yds 6 TD (missed most of season with injury, currently rehabing) As a Soph, 2,200 pass yds 23 TDs, 404 rush yds and 11 TDs. According to ESPN, Cooper is a 4* prospect, the #8 QB with an 82 grade, and the number 98 overall prospect.
For video highlights; http://www.hudl.com/athlete/3330714/zerrick-cooper

A read: "Clemson 2016 QB commit Zerrick Cooper was one of five high school quarterbacks that ESPN compared favorably to Heisman award-winner Marcus Mariota in terms of being under-valued in high school but with loads of potential."

"He missed his whole junior season due to a torn ACL," said ESPN recruiting analyst Gerry Hamilton in a Recruiting Nation video. "In recruiting you are kind of forgotten if you don't play. While Clemson fans are familiar with him there is no junior video. There is no further evaluation for Cooper. So while he is ranked No. 98 in the ESPN 300 he hasn't been seen since last spring essentially. Since he is rehabbing his knee he more likely will not compete in any Elite 11 or quarterback challenges and probably not in spring practice. So he is a guy that will head into his senior year, while he is ranked, it is really an unknown the level of talent that he is right now. He is a 6-5, 200-pound kid. He is physically gifted with a high upside. So he is essentially a year behind other quarterbacks right now. Again that makes his ceiling very high."

QB/ Ath - Chazz Surratt 6-3 210 East Lincoln High, Denver, NC

Gave a verbal to Duke on 4/21/15. Offered by Clemson on 10/1/13. 4* #11 QB by Yahoo Rivals. 24/7 Composite #11 Dual Threat QB, # 317 overall. Runs a 4.5 40. Recently led East Lincoln to a 16-0 season, 2A state title and was named State Player of the Year by NCPreps. This is his second state title while at the helm for East Lincoln. He completed 66.3 percent of his passes for 4,349 yards and 53 touchdowns with 13 interceptions while rushing for 1,272 yards and 20 touchdowns. Surratt broke Chris Leak’s state record for total yards in a season. In 2012, had 562 rush yds with 8 TDs, 288 pass yds 2 TDs, 56 catches for 1,107 yds 13 TDs, 64 tackles with two sacks and 4 INTs. Has offers from UT, UNC, GT, Wake, NCSU, BC, Duke, and ECU. Has played QB, RB, WR, and DB. Is a tremendous athlete who can plays multiple positions. Also has a 4.4 GPA. Also a basketball player.

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=jhbfuLFpgxM


Video highlights: www.hudl.com/athlete/1580351/highlights/.../v2


Short read on Surratt from opposing coach Sean Joyce, "Joyce remembers how a heavy rain pelted the field in the fourth quarter. He thought it might slow East Lincoln’s passing game. Joyce changed his defense to position more defenders near the line of scrimmage. “The whole time, I’m sitting there thinking, ‘No way they’re going to throw in this weather. We’ll send pressure,’ ” Joyce said. “And doggone it, if (Chazz) didn’t throw a strike, about 60 yards in the air. That broke our back.”
